Inspiring the next generation of solar innovators
The G3 Energy Summit is an annual student-led Energy Conference co-organised by the Energy societies of LSE, Imperial, Cambridge University and UCL on the current development in the energy sector. The summit has been recognised as the biggest student-led energy summit across Europe, bringing together leaders from across industry, politics and academia to discuss trends and issues within the energy sector.
This year’s topic was “Transitioning the UK to Net Zero”, and Lightsource bp was proud to be represented by Leo Kellock, Senior Solar Technology Engineer in our Innovation team. Leo works across a number of projects and initiatives designed to push the boundaries of technology and renewable energy at Lightsource bp, and he took part in the first panel – “Solving the Technical Challenges of Decarbonisation”.
Speaking on why he felt it was important to attend the Summit, Leo said: “It’s vital as a solar company that the case is made for our part in the energy transition, especially to the next generation of engineers and economists. From the depth of knowledge and engagement from the audience you could see that the full gravity and complexity of this incredibly tough task is being understood and taken on by the next generation.”
At Lightsource bp, events like this are a key part of how we’re going beyond solar to make a real difference. We send speakers to educational events, invite universities to visit our solar projects, create educational resources for local schools, run apprenticeships and internship programs and more. Empowering the next generation to help the energy transition to renewables is important to us, and activities like these allow us to educate and inspire people across a wide range of disciplines.
